  2. Greetings all! Was driving & thought the clutch cable was about to give up; however, on opening up the hood, inspecting the clutch cables, found there were not one but two cables. I am used to only one in old Subarus. This one has one cable adjusted tight, the other adjusted loose. I have not seen anything like it. When I tightened the loose cable, it caused the gears to grind. The cables themselves seemed to be in good condition, not needing replacement. I don't have a manual and someone stole the reference copy out of our local library. I can't drive to any other library as I live in a remote mountain town and just have this one Subaru. Q: Is a model with a HH clutch hydrolic or vacuum-assisted? Q: Can anyone give me advise as to proper adjustment or, locating the problem(s)? thanks!
